In 1985, Wu Xiaoliang was born in Tongliao City, Inner Mongolia, with single eyelids and a pointed chin, and he has a unique Mongolian appearance.

Wu Xiaoliang: The lowest-key movie emperor! In the 17 years since his debut, he has only played the male lead once, and has been a resident singer in a bar

His father was a lawyer and his mother was an ordinary worker, although neither of his parents engaged in literary and artistic work, Wu Xiaoliang was very interested in music since he was a child.

In that era of rock and roll, having his own band and becoming a rock star like Dou Wei was Wu Xiaoliang's buried dream.

At first, his mother did not agree to buy him an instrument, coaxing him to say that he could earn money to buy it when he grew up, but Wu Xiaoliang told his mother that although he could make money to buy it in the future, he might not want to play when he grew up.

The mother thought about it again and again, thinking that her son had a point, so she agreed to buy him an instrument.

At the age of 16, Wu Xiaoliang formed his first band and served as the lead singer, fortunately, he did not treat the music as a 3-minute heat, but seriously insisted on it.

Wu Xiaoliang: The lowest-key movie emperor! In the 17 years since his debut, he has only played the male lead once, and has been a resident singer in a bar

Until the age of 18, Wu Xiaoliang was admitted to the Central Institute for Nationalities majoring in composition with excellent results.

During college, Wu Xiaoliang often used his spare time to go to the bar to stay, first, to reduce the burden on the family, and second, to accumulate experience and fame for himself.

Maybe by sticking to it, Wu Xiaoliang will become a popular resident singer, but fate changed one day in 2004.

On this day, Wu Xiaoliang carried the guitar to the bar as usual, and a film director on the stage looked at Wu Xiaoliang, who was singing, and felt that he was very close to the film role he had recently prepared, so he invited him to the crew to audition.

Wu Xiaoliang: The lowest-key movie emperor! In the 17 years since his debut, he has only played the male lead once, and has been a resident singer in a bar

Although Wu Xiaoliang did not have any acting experience, the audition was surprisingly smooth.

In this way, Wu Xiaoliang starred in his first film "Dancing Without Music", which won the Chinese Film Huabiao Award a year after the film was broadcast, and Wu Xiaoliang was also deeply loved by the director and starred in his second film "Adolescence".

Just by mistake, Wu Xiaoliang crossed from the music circle to the film and television circle.

In the next few years, Wu Xiaoliang shuttled through different crews, youth dramas, war dramas, urban emotional dramas, costume suspense dramas, and all different types of roles were tried by him.

Although most of the actors played in the play are supporting roles, he can still show his superb acting skills in a few shots, and each performance can not only be recognized by the audience, but also recognized by the same crew actors and directors.

Because Wu Xiaoliang and Huang Xuan became good friends during filming, on the day of Huang Xuan's TV series "Muyun on the Sea", Wu Xiaoliang deliberately went to the crew to visit the class, but he did not expect to be caught by the director Cao Dun on the scene.

Wu Xiaoliang: The lowest-key movie emperor! In the 17 years since his debut, he has only played the male lead once, and has been a resident singer in a bar

In this way, Wu Xiaoliang had the opportunity to play the role of Cao Shaoyan in "The Twelve Hours of Chang'an", and it was this role that made Wu Xiaoliang really catch fire.

In 2018, Wu Xiaoliang, who has been a supporting role for 14 years, starred in his first male lead drama "Under the Sun", and won the Best Actor Award at the 4th Macao International Film Festival "New Chinese Image" for this film.

Although he became a movie emperor, due to the lack of public in the movie, his attention was still not high, until the role of Sun Xing in "Sweeping Black Storm" 3 years later, let everyone really see him.

Wu Xiaoliang has a distinctive face, but he can achieve a thousand faces in the play, and many people lament that Cao Baoyan in "The Twelve Hours of Chang'an" is actually Sun Xing in "Sweeping The Black Storm".

However, he did not find that in the movies "Embroidered Spring Knife" and "The Wandering Earth", Wu Xiaoliang had also appeared on camera.

Even if the scenes are not much, he still takes it seriously, and when filming "Embroidery Spring Knife", because the character's weapon is a 170-centimeter wolf's tooth stick, he insisted on practicing with a 20-kilogram physical wooden stick before filming began.
